2cf0a0e9b6dd0fa6e34530639dcf3dde.json 9.9 KB

1
  1. {"remainingRequest":"D:\\wnmp\\www\\vue\\seaBlueAdmin\\node_modules\\babel-loader\\lib\\index.js!D:\\wnmp\\www\\vue\\seaBlueAdmin\\node_modules\\cache-loader\\dist\\cjs.js??ref--0-0!D:\\wnmp\\www\\vue\\seaBlueAdmin\\node_modules\\vue-loader\\lib\\index.js??vue-loader-options!D:\\wnmp\\www\\vue\\seaBlueAdmin\\src\\views\\ExpireTip.vue?vue&type=script&lang=js&","dependencies":[{"path":"D:\\wnmp\\www\\vue\\seaBlueAdmin\\src\\views\\ExpireTip.vue","mtime":1678954023539},{"path":"D:\\wnmp\\www\\vue\\seaBlueAdmin\\babel.config.js","mtime":1681371897685},{"path":"D:\\wnmp\\www\\vue\\seaBlueAdmin\\node_modules\\cache-loader\\dist\\cjs.js","mtime":1681371913603},{"path":"D:\\wnmp\\www\\vue\\seaBlueAdmin\\node_modules\\babel-loader\\lib\\index.js","mtime":1681371912860},{"path":"D:\\wnmp\\www\\vue\\seaBlueAdmin\\node_modules\\cache-loader\\dist\\cjs.js","mtime":1681371913603},{"path":"D:\\wnmp\\www\\vue\\seaBlueAdmin\\node_modules\\vue-loader\\lib\\index.js","mtime":1681371925849}],"contextDependencies":[],"result":[{"type":"Buffer","data":"base64:Ly8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KLy8KaW1wb3J0IHsgbWFwQWN0aW9ucyB9IGZyb20gInZ1ZXgiOwpleHBvcnQgZGVmYXVsdCB7CiAgbmFtZTogIlBhZ2U0MDEiLAoKICBkYXRhKCkgewogICAgcmV0dXJuIHsKICAgICAganVtcFRpbWU6IDUsCiAgICAgIG9vcHM6ICLmirHmrYkhIiwKICAgICAgaGVhZGxpbmU6ICLlha3niZvnp5HmioDmnI3liqHlt7LliLDmnJ8uLi4iLAogICAgICBpbmZvOiAi5b2T5YmN5biQ5Y+35rKh5pyJ5pON5L2c5p2D6ZmQLOivt+iBlOezu+euoeeQhuWRmOOAgiIsCiAgICAgIGJ0bjogIui/lOWbniIsCiAgICAgIHRpbWVyOiAwCiAgICB9OwogIH0sCgogIGNvbXB1dGVkOiB7CiAgICBub3dFeHBpcmVUaW1lKCkgewogICAgICByZXR1cm4gdGhpcy4kc3RvcmUuZ2V0dGVyc1siTVVzZXIvbm93RXhwaXJlVGltZSJdOwogICAgfQoKICB9LAoKICBiZWZvcmVEZXN0cm95KCkgewogICAgY2xlYXJJbnRlcnZhbCh0aGlzLnRpbWVyKTsKICB9LAoKICBtb3VudGVkKCkgewogICAgdGhpcy50aW1lQ2hhbmdlKCk7CiAgfSwKCiAgbWV0aG9kczogeyAuLi5tYXBBY3Rpb25zKHsKICAgICAgZGVsVmlzaXRlZFJvdXRlOiAidGFnc0Jhci9kZWxWaXNpdGVkUm91dGUiLAogICAgICBkZWxPdGhlcnNWaXNpdGVkUm91dGVzOiAidGFnc0Jhci9kZWxPdGhlcnNWaXNpdGVkUm91dGVzIgogICAgfSksCgogICAgYmFja3BhZ2UoKSB7CiAgICAgIGlmICh0aGlzLnN5c3RlbVR5cGUgPT09IDMpIHsKICAgICAgICB0aGlzLiRyb3V0ZXIucHVzaCh7CiAgICAgICAgICBwYXRoOiAiL011bHRpTWVyY2hhbnQiCiAgICAgICAgfSk7CiAgICAgICAgdGhpcy5kZWxPdGhlcnNWaXNpdGVkUm91dGVzKHsKICAgICAgICAgIHBhdGg6ICIvTXVsdGlNZXJjaGFudCIKICAgICAgICB9KTsKICAgICAgfSBlbHNlIHsKICAgICAgICB0aGlzLiRyb3V0ZXIucHVzaCh7CiAgICAgICAgICBwYXRoOiAiLyIKICAgICAgICB9KTsKICAgICAgICB0aGlzLmRlbE90aGVyc1Zpc2l0ZWRSb3V0ZXMoewogICAgICAgICAgcGF0aDogIi8iCiAgICAgICAgfSk7CiAgICAgIH0KCiAgICAgIGNsZWFySW50ZXJ2YWwodGhpcy50aW1lcik7CiAgICB9LAoKICAgIHRpbWVDaGFuZ2UoKSB7CiAgICAgIHRoaXMudGltZXIgPSBzZXRJbnRlcnZhbCgoKSA9PiB7CiAgICAgICAgaWYgKHRoaXMuanVtcFRpbWUpIHsKICAgICAgICAgIHRoaXMuanVtcFRpbWUtLTsKICAgICAgICB9IGVsc2UgewogICAgICAgICAgLy8gdGhpcy4kcm91dGVyLnB1c2goeyBwYXRoOiAiLyIgfSk7CiAgICAgICAgICAvLyB0aGlzLmRlbE90aGVyc1Zpc2l0ZWRSb3V0ZXMoeyBwYXRoOiAiLyIgfSk7CiAgICAgICAgICAvLyBjbGVhckludGVydmFsKHRoaXMudGltZXIpOwogICAgICAgICAgdGhpcy5iYWNrcGFnZSgpOwogICAgICAgIH0KICAgICAgfSwgMTAwMCk7CiAgICB9CgogIH0KfTs="},{"version":3,"mappings":";;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;AAuCA;AACA;EACAA,eADA;;EAEAC;IACA;MACAC,WADA;MAEAC,WAFA;MAGAC,wBAHA;MAIAC,0BAJA;MAKAC,SALA;MAMAC;IANA;EAQA,CAXA;;EAYAC;IACAC;MACA;IACA;;EAHA,CAZA;;EAiBAC;IACAC;EACA,CAnBA;;EAoBAC;IACA;EACA,CAtBA;;EAuBAC,WACA;MACAC,0CADA;MAEAC;IAFA,EADA;;IAKAC;MACA;QACA;UAAAC;QAAA;QACA;UAAAA;QAAA;MACA,CAHA,MAGA;QACA;UAAAA;QAAA;QACA;UAAAA;QAAA;MACA;;MACAN;IACA,CAdA;;IAeAO;MACA;QACA;UACA;QACA,CAFA,MAEA;UACA;UACA;UACA;UACA;QACA;MACA,CATA,EASA,IATA;IAUA;;EA1BA;AAvBA","names":["name","data","jumpTime","oops","headline","info","btn","timer","computed","nowExpireTime","beforeDestroy","clearInterval","mounted","methods","delVisitedRoute","delOthersVisitedRoutes","backpage","path","timeChange"],"sourceRoot":"src/views","sources":["ExpireTip.vue"],"sourcesContent":["<template>\n <div class=\"error-container\">\n <div class=\"error-content\">\n <el-row :gutter=\"20\">\n <el-col :lg=\"12\" :md=\"12\" :sm=\"24\" :xl=\"12\" :xs=\"24\">\n <div class=\"pic-error\">\n <img class=\"pic-error-parent\" src=\"@/assets/error_images/401.png\" />\n <img\n class=\"pic-error-child left\"\n src=\"@/assets/error_images/cloud.png\"\n />\n </div>\n </el-col>\n\n <el-col :lg=\"12\" :md=\"12\" :sm=\"24\" :xl=\"12\" :xs=\"24\">\n <div class=\"bullshit\">\n <div class=\"bullshit-oops\">{{ oops }}</div>\n <div class=\"bullshit-headline\">{{ headline }}</div>\n <div class=\"bullshit-info\">\n <p>\n 您购买的{{ enterprise_title }}服务, 已于{{\n $_common.formatDate(nowExpireTime)\n }}到期。 请尽快联系客服续费续费,以免影响您的正常使用!\n </p>\n <p style=\"padding-top: 10px; color: #000000\">\n 客服电话(同微信):*****\n </p>\n </div>\n <div class=\"bullshit-return-home\" @click=\"backpage\">\n {{ jumpTime }}s&nbsp;{{ btn }}\n </div>\n </div>\n </el-col>\n </el-row>\n </div>\n </div>\n</template>\n\n<script>\n import { mapActions } from \"vuex\";\n export default {\n name: \"Page401\",\n data() {\n return {\n jumpTime: 5,\n oops: \"抱歉!\",\n headline: \"六牛科技服务已到期...\",\n info: \"当前帐号没有操作权限,请联系管理员。\",\n btn: \"返回\",\n timer: 0,\n };\n },\n computed: {\n nowExpireTime() {\n return this.$store.getters[\"MUser/nowExpireTime\"];\n },\n },\n beforeDestroy() {\n clearInterval(this.timer);\n },\n mounted() {\n this.timeChange();\n },\n methods: {\n ...mapActions({\n delVisitedRoute: \"tagsBar/delVisitedRoute\",\n delOthersVisitedRoutes: \"tagsBar/delOthersVisitedRoutes\",\n }),\n backpage() {\n if (this.systemType === 3) {\n this.$router.push({ path: \"/MultiMerchant\" });\n this.delOthersVisitedRoutes({ path: \"/MultiMerchant\" });\n } else {\n this.$router.push({ path: \"/\" });\n this.delOthersVisitedRoutes({ path: \"/\" });\n }\n clearInterval(this.timer);\n },\n timeChange() {\n this.timer = setInterval(() => {\n if (this.jumpTime) {\n this.jumpTime--;\n } else {\n // this.$router.push({ path: \"/\" });\n // this.delOthersVisitedRoutes({ path: \"/\" });\n // clearInterval(this.timer);\n this.backpage();\n }\n }, 1000);\n },\n },\n };\n</script>\n\n<style scoped lang=\"scss\">\n .error-container {\n position: relative;\n min-height: 100vh;\n\n .error-content {\n position: absolute;\n top: 55%;\n left: 50%;\n width: 40vw;\n height: 400px;\n transform: translate(-50%, -50%);\n\n .pic-error {\n position: relative;\n float: left;\n width: 100%;\n overflow: hidden;\n\n &-parent {\n width: 100%;\n }\n\n &-child {\n position: absolute;\n\n &.left {\n top: 17px;\n left: 220px;\n width: 80px;\n opacity: 0;\n animation-name: cloudLeft;\n animation-duration: 2s;\n animation-timing-function: linear;\n animation-delay: 1s;\n animation-fill-mode: forwards;\n }\n\n @keyframes cloudLeft {\n 0% {\n top: 17px;\n left: 220px;\n opacity: 0;\n }\n\n 20% {\n top: 33px;\n left: 188px;\n opacity: 1;\n }\n\n 80% {\n top: 81px;\n left: 92px;\n opacity: 1;\n }\n\n 100% {\n top: 97px;\n left: 60px;\n opacity: 0;\n }\n }\n }\n }\n\n .bullshit {\n position: relative;\n float: left;\n width: 300px;\n padding: 30px 0;\n overflow: hidden;\n\n &-oops {\n margin-bottom: 20px;\n font-size: 32px;\n font-weight: bold;\n line-height: 40px;\n color: $base-color-blue;\n opacity: 0;\n animation-name: slideUp;\n animation-duration: 0.5s;\n animation-fill-mode: forwards;\n }\n\n &-headline {\n margin-bottom: 10px;\n font-size: 20px;\n font-weight: bold;\n line-height: 24px;\n color: #222;\n opacity: 0;\n animation-name: slideUp;\n animation-duration: 0.5s;\n animation-delay: 0.1s;\n animation-fill-mode: forwards;\n }\n\n &-info {\n margin-bottom: 30px;\n font-size: 13px;\n line-height: 21px;\n color: $base-color-gray;\n opacity: 0;\n animation-name: slideUp;\n animation-duration: 0.5s;\n animation-delay: 0.2s;\n animation-fill-mode: forwards;\n }\n\n &-return-home {\n display: block;\n float: left;\n width: 110px;\n height: 36px;\n font-size: 14px;\n line-height: 36px;\n color: #fff;\n text-align: center;\n cursor: pointer;\n background: $base-color-blue;\n border-radius: 100px;\n opacity: 0;\n animation-name: slideUp;\n animation-duration: 0.5s;\n animation-delay: 0.3s;\n animation-fill-mode: forwards;\n }\n\n @keyframes slideUp {\n 0% {\n opacity: 0;\n transform: translateY(60px);\n }\n\n 100% {\n opacity: 1;\n transform: translateY(0);\n }\n }\n }\n }\n }\n</style>\n"]}]}